Rice retires, new Executive Director hired for Downtown Association
Helen Rice has made a slow transition into retirement over the past few years as she steps away from her position as Manager of the Grande Prairie Downtown Association.*
A couple years ago she stepped away from the Alberta Urban Municipalities Association board and in the most recent municipal election, she decided not to run again for a position on Grande Prairie City Council. She will maintain her spot on the Board of Directors for Energy Efficiency Alberta as well as the position of Chair for their audit committee. Rice will also keep her spot on the Local Government Managers Association.
Although her thoughts about retirement are all over the place, Rice says she is happy that she phased out her workload the way she did.
“It is sort of up and down. It is exciting, it is also ‘oh my goodness, did I get everything done that I wanted to do’ and ‘how will I stop myself from butting my nose in for the next months or weeks or years’. I go all over the landscape I guess you could say.”
